Bearcat Caves Exploration

Kamloops Trails Posted on 2025-09-26 by dsmith2025-09-11  

We had heard about the Bearcat Caves located in the Monte Hills and we decided to try to find the caves then explore them.    We returned several times, each time exploring farther along the caves and fissures and trying new routes where there was safe access.   To get to the Bearcat Caves, we go to Monte Lake and at the north end of the lake, we take the Monte Hills FSR.     The area has been logged many times and there are lots of side roads.    We had coordinates for the caves area so we followed backroads that took us to the trailhead.    A geocache listing provided lots of useful information – Bearcat Caves.

There are no trail signs and there is lots of windfall, but there may be some flagging tape and a faint trail.     The holes/entrances are scattered over the area and there are probably more closer to the cliffs overlooking the Salmon River Valley.   The cave with the geocache in it was the easiest to get into.    We can hike right through that one.     We found 3 other caves/fissures that offered good scrambling.     In one of the caves is a 100 foot drop down the Ice Slide.    Without a rope, that would be a “keeper.”    Some of the routes are just deep fissures with light from above, but some go down tunnels.    Anyone who goes there needs to wear a helmet (easy to bash your head in the dark), needs to have a headlamp and/or a flashlight, needs to use good hiking boots, and may want to carry a rope.   Exploring these caves alone is not advisable and it would be unsuitable for children and pets.

I have done the caves a few times and have taken small groups through the fissures and into the tunnels.    It is not for everyone and generally speaking suited to fit, strong experienced adults who don’t mind going underground.
